Cruise Ships Return to Mexico

One of the biggest sources of tourism in Mexico is from cruise ships that bring millions of visitors each year. For example, in 2019 nearly 9 million visitors came to Mexico on cruise ships. However, due to the unprecedented impacts of COVID-19, tourism was significantly affected in 2020 and 2021. As COVID vaccinations are currently underway, many places are hoping to regain a sense of normalcy. As we make our way into the second half of 2021, the gradual return of cruise ships is expected in Mexico thanks to safety measures that are in place. Cruise Ships Return to Mexico

Some of the cruise line companies that are returning to Mexico include Holland America. They will arrive in October with a new route for the Nieuw Amsterdam, which is the second largest ship in its fleet. Holland America’s Zuiderdam and the Koningsdam will also resume operations from San Diego in fall of 2021 and spring of 2022. In addition, Carnival is also expected to offer cruise packages from California with stops in Cabo, Puerto Vallarta and Mazatlán. Similarly, Royal Caribbean will soon return to Cozumel, a port that typically receives half of the cruise market in Mexico. Other popular stops in Mexico include Cancun, Cabo, Puerto Vallarta and the Riviera Maya. These top destinations are working on health protocols to safely receive cruise ship visitors within the next few months.
